Detailed Specs & Features

According to specs, the Corsair ML140 is a PC cooling fan released in 2022, designed exclusively for indoor use with case mounting capability, emphasizing its niche in maintaining computer component temperatures. It features a maximum speed of 2000 RPM and a variable PWM speed setting, allowing precise airflow control ranging from 400 RPM up to 2000 RPM. 

Its fan blade diameter of 5.5 inches and seven blades ensure robust airflow capacity, categorized as high, which points toward significant cooling potential within PC cases. The power requirements are modest, operating on a standard 12 Volt power supply consuming up to 4.8 watts at maximum speed, which aligns well with typical PC power parameters and contributes to very good energy efficiency

In terms of noise, the ML140 performs exceptionally well, registering only 37 dB at peak speed and as low as 20 dB when running at minimal speeds. This quiet operation is further supported by features such as a vibration reduction design, motor noise isolation, and blade balance technology. 

These specs collectively indicate a meticulous design focus on reducing acoustic distractions without sacrificing airflow performance. The fan's build utilizes premium quality plastic components finished with a matte look, available in blue, red, and white colors. With a weight of just 0.43 pounds and a sleek profile, it promises easy installation without imposing physical stress on the case.

User Experience & Performance (Based on Specs)

Design & Build

From the engineering data, the Corsair ML140 offers a durable plastic main body complemented by plastic fan blades designed for longevity and stability. The matte finish not only adds to the aesthetic appeal but also lends subtle scratch resistance, though the specs denote that full scratch resistance is not guaranteed. 

What stands out most is its design intention centered around easy mounting; the fan is built to be case-mounted with included mounting hardware, rated as having an easy installation difficulty level. While it lacks tool-free assembly and adjustable tilt, its lightweight and compact dimensions (5.51 inches depth and height, less than an inch width) make it unobtrusive in most PC builds. The device's rust-resistant quality assures longer life even in varying indoor conditions.

Performance

In daily use, the fan's airflow capacity marked as "high" and cooling effectiveness rated "excellent" promises efficient heat dissipation for demanding PC setups, including gaming rigs and workstations. The fan speed modulation (PWM) allows users to customize cooling performance precisely, enabling silent operation at lower speeds and significant airflow at higher settings. 

The noise profile is impressively low for a fan running up to 2000 RPM, with integrated vibration and noise control technologies enhancing comfort during extended use. Although it lacks advanced modes such as turbo or natural breeze, the fan excels in providing steady, dependable air circulation without sudden noise spikes or audible clicks.
